India fortifies space capabilities as orbital conflict becomes strategic reality

India is accelerating development of space-based military capabilities and resilience measures as strategic planners increasingly view orbital domains as potential conflict zones. The move underscores New Delhi's recognition that future geopolitical contests may extend beyond terrestrial boundaries, requiring robust technological infrastructure and defensive mechanisms in space.

The Indian space programme has expanded its focus from civilian applications to include strategic defence components. Enhanced satellite communications, earth observation systems, and anti-satellite awareness capabilities are being developed to protect national interests and maintain strategic autonomy in an increasingly contested orbital environment.

Global space militarisation has prompted India to strengthen its technological footprint and operational readiness. Several nations are developing capabilities to disrupt or disable adversary satellites, creating urgent imperatives for countries to ensure their own orbital assets remain secure and functional during crisis scenarios.

Experts note that India's approach balances indigenous capability development with international engagement. The country is simultaneously advancing its space technology sector while participating in global discussions on space security norms, positioning itself as a responsible spacefaring nation concerned with sustainable orbital practices.

As space becomes increasingly integrated with national security infrastructure—from communications to surveillance—India's investment reflects broader regional dynamics where technological superiority and strategic preparedness across all domains, including space, have become essential to national defence considerations.
